The Only Browser Stats That Matter

We all know that browsers render sites differently, some browsers have awesome support for HTML5 and CSS3 standards, and other browsers are IE. But the truth is that there's only one set of browser stats that matter, and that's your own. In this persuasive article Chris Coyier explains how to design for your own traffic.

Ghost 1.0 Released

Probably the biggest thing to happen to blogging software since WordPress, Ghost has just reached a landmark 100 releases, and it also happens to be version 1.0.0! Packed with new features, but still not burdened by the spaghetti code of other platforms, Ghost is rapidly becoming the writer's first choice for publishing online.

IBM iX logo

IBM iX is the design and consulting division of technology behemoth IBM, and true to form, the in-house team have developed a timeless and incredibly versatile logo for the studio. Constructed from two diamonds and a cross, it's a lesson in minimalism and effective branding. In a world where quality design often gets diluted by business concerns, this is a gem.

Wantedly People

Wantedly People is an app for iOS and Android that allows you to build up a network of contacts quickly by scanning 10 business cards at a time. Powered by AI and OCR (optical character recognition) you can digitize your card collection and start messaging people in seconds. It's an amazing way to convert the cards stuffing up your drawer into useful digital contacts.
